Here's a guide to what does and … WebIn addition to federal income tax collected by the United States, most individual U.S. states collect a state income tax.Some local governments also impose an income tax, often based on state income tax calculations. Forty-two states and many localities in the United States impose an income tax on individuals. Eight states impose no state income tax, …

The following eight states have no income tax whatsoever: Alaska Florida Nevada South Dakota Tennessee Texas Washington Wyoming Additionally, New... Web6 sep. 2024 · Multi-State Taxation. If an employer has operations in more than one state, income tax might need to be withheld for multiple states. In fact, at times the employer might need to withhold income tax for multiple states from the wages of one employee. Withholding can become complicated when an employee lives in one state and works in …
